|
好多年前玩过书剑的MUD。上周心血来潮,又开始再次尝试。
好像变化蛮大,不过具体的感想还是等级高了以后再说吧。
这次注册的是kl的男号。论坛的资源蛮齐全,直接找到巡城的机器人,挂了起来。
不过,在使用过程中,还是发现了若干可以改进的地方,用这一两天的时间,一边挂一边改,在原有基础上,稍修整了一下。
现共享出来,希望能给后续的kl玩家带来更大的便利。
首先,必须说的是,感谢原机器人的作者,没有这个老的基础,下述一切更改都无从谈起。
然后,下面是具体的改进内容,供下载参考:
1——读书写字的学习,自动进行。
原来的机器人中,是随时根据情况,手动选的,要不要进行读书写字。如果不去选或者选完后学习满脸,后面自己不会再去的。
考虑到sj里面读书写字是5级一个档次的(早年是这样,不知道现在是不是还是这个算法。如果有误,还请指出,我来调整。),所以现在做的效果是:每当等级在5的整数倍时,就会自动跑去把读书写字补到满。这样,挂机就不用考虑读书的事情了。
2——加了一个自定义技能列表的按钮。
原有机器人中,学习什么,使用一个内建的变量固定的。每次手动修订会有些烦。
所以,在原有的5个按钮的最右侧,加入了第六个按钮,可以自定义学习的技能项,供随时调整。
这个机器人,技能学习是,每次都重新从技能项列表最前面一个学起,学满了自动学下一个。全学满了,会跑去巡城。所以,技能项列表不能太少。当然,太多的话,后面的基本就是摆设,学不到。
3——加入了一些学习过程中的状态切换。
原有机器人中,因为学习的技能是固定的,所以不存在问题。
但是,因为现在可以自定义技能了。反而带来一些状态的问题。比如,学拳和学剑的时候,一个要空手,一个要拿剑。
那么,现在加入了一些自动的判断和处理。可以根据学习的内容,自动去剑房拿剑装备,或者卸下剑了。
4——加了些状态栏和状态窗的代码。
原来的机器人,一直在跑,但是,一样看过去,是不知道当前在做什么的,还有当前状态怎样。
现在加入了状态栏,随时可以知道当前在做啥。
事实上,这项改进最大的用处是,如果机器人当了或出错了,可以知道自己处于什么状态。
比如:有没有任务在身,是在回山还是在下山途中,等等。
另外,也加入了状态窗,里面的信息更多一些。游戏中,可以打开状态窗随时了解当前的状况。
推荐把zmud的窗口拖小,放在旮旯里,桌面上放一个状态窗,就能随时了解当前的情况了。
另外:我不知道状态窗和状态栏的代码是不是在mud文件里。所以,如果mud文件加载后没有的话,手动加入下述代码。
状态栏: 当前状态:@0_dqzt 当前潜能:@0_qn 读书写字:@0_wenhua
状态窗:
当前状态:@0_dqzt
当前潜能:@0_qn
等级上限:@0_jbmax - 读书写字:@0_wenhua
5级整倍:@0_mod5 - 差值:@001
学什么,0-武功,1-文化:@xuelit
学习项:@skill - 当前等级:@0_dqdj
@skillslist
嗯~~~基本就这些。因为实际用的时间只有两天不到。所以,就是粗浅改了下。
如果还有什么需要,随时联系,我尽力而为。
brighthm@tx,淡晓朦
Klxc_Abilly_Weir_1.2.mud
(110.44 KB, 下载次数: 31)
|
|